Duties:
  • Develops and maintains nursing service objectives and standards of nursing practice in accordance with the nursing policies and procedures
  • Assesses each resident's needs and assists in the development of a treatment plan for nursing care to meet the daily treatment and care needs of the resident
  • Participates in the interdisciplinary team and works cooperatively with team members to ensure the coordination of care and treatment for the residents are met
  • Ensures that nursing personnel provide treatments, medications, diets, rehabilitative nursing care, activities of daily living, protective service, and training in self-care as stated in the care plan to ascertain that optimum comfort and care is provided
  • Train nursing staff in the proper provision of direct care to residents
  • Lead others through actions consistent with and serve our culture
Qualifications:
  • Current RN or LVN license is required
  • Minimum of 2 years of Long Term Care experience preferred
  • Able to handle stressful situations in a calm and professional manner
